Common Questions: JetBlue Plus Card vs Wells Fargo Autograph Journey

Is the JetBlue Plus Card or Wells Fargo Autograph Journey better for dining?

JetBlue Plus Card earns 2x on dining; Wells Fargo Autograph Journey earns 3x on dining. Wells Fargo Autograph Journey wins for dining.

Which has the higher signup bonus in 2026?

JetBlue Plus Card currently offers 70,000 pts signup bonus (spend $1,000 in 3 months). Wells Fargo Autograph Journey offers 60,000 pts signup bonus (spend $4,000 in 3 months). JetBlue Plus Card has the larger bonus.

Which card is better for international travel?

Both cards charge no foreign transaction fees, making either a solid choice for international travel.

Can I hold both the JetBlue Plus Card and the Wells Fargo Autograph Journey?

In most cases yes — holding both is allowed and can be a smart strategy for maximizing rewards across different spending categories. JetBlue Plus Card is from Barclays and Wells Fargo Autograph Journey is from Wells Fargo, so they're governed by separate bank policies.
